Chemistry Check For Cougar Relationships

Attraction is a great start, but real compatibility comes from understanding how your lives and expectations align. Whether you’re an older woman seeking a younger partner or someone interested in dating a cougar, use these practical checks to see if chemistry can grow into something steady and respectful.

Talk About Relationship Goals

Start early and be direct about what you each want. Are you looking for casual dating, companionship, mentorship, or a long-term partnership? People in this category can want any of these—don’t assume intentions based on age or label alone. Saying your goals out loud helps avoid mismatched expectations later.

Compare Lifestyle And Energy

Discuss daily rhythms, social habits, travel preferences, career demands, and how you like to spend weekends. Differences in energy levels or schedules are normal, but ask: can you adjust without resenting it? Look for practical overlap—shared hobbies, travel interests, or similar tolerance for social activity—that makes time together sustainable.

Align On Values And Priorities

Values guide tough choices. Talk about family, finances, commitment, privacy, and how you handle change. You don’t need identical beliefs, but notice where you both draw firm lines and where you’re flexible. Respect for each other’s priorities is more important than matching them exactly.

Discuss Communication Style And Conflict

Ask how the other person prefers to give and receive feedback. Do they like to talk things through right away or take time to reflect? Share a recent example of resolving a disagreement and listen for compatible patterns—timing, tone, and willingness to compromise matter more than winning an argument.

Set Boundaries And Expectations

Clear boundaries protect both people’s dignity. Be explicit about emotional availability, public displays of affection, social circles, and any age-related concerns that matter to you. Check in regularly—boundaries can shift as a relationship deepens.

Thoughtful Questions To Ask Early

  • What are you hoping to get out of dating right now?
  • How do you balance work, hobbies, and relationships?
  • What does a healthy relationship look like to you?
  • How do you handle money and financial decision-making?
  • Are there non-negotiables I should know about?
  • How do you like to spend downtime or recharge?

Watch For Respect And Curiosity

True chemistry includes mutual curiosity and respect. Notice whether conversations stay reciprocal, how quickly either person stereotypes or pigeonholes the other, and whether both people show interest in each other’s inner lives—not just appearances or age. Small signals—listening closely, remembering details, and following up on topics—often predict long-term compatibility better than intense early passion.

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work

Feeling stuck on what to say is normal—useful openers are often more about curiosity than cleverness. Start with short, adaptable patterns you can personalize instead of relying on generic lines or forced compliments.

Patterns You Can Use Right Away

  • Observation + question: Notice one specific thing in their profile or photo, then ask a light question. Example: “I see your hiking photo—which trail was that? Any favorites nearby?”
  • Choice question: Give two easy options to lower the reply effort. Example: “Coffee shop chat or park stroll—what’s your pick?”
  • Fun curiosity: Ask about a hobby or item they mention in a playful way. Example: “You play guitar—what’s one song you never get tired of playing?”
  • Low-pressure compliment + follow-up: Keep compliments specific and pair them with a question. Example: “Nice travel photos—what’s one place you’d go back to tomorrow?”

How To Personalize Without Overthinking

  • Scan for small details: a book title, a pet, a band, a food item—use that as your hook.
  • Keep it short: one to two sentences invite responses more often than long messages.
  • Match tone: if their profile is playful, mirror that; if it’s straightforward, be direct.

What To Avoid

  • Generic openers like “Hey” or “Sup” with no context—those are easy to ignore.
  • Overly intense questions on the first message (life goals, exes, marriage timelines).
  • Copy-paste lines that could apply to anyone—they feel impersonal.
  • Forced flattery about looks without a follow-up; instead, comment on something they chose to show or say.

Quick Templates To Adapt

  1. “Love that [detail]. How did you get into it?”
  2. “I’m torn between [option A] and [option B]. Which would you choose?”
  3. “That photo at [place/activity] looks fun—what’s the story behind it?”
  4. “If you had one free weekend, would you rather [activity A] or [activity B]?”
